Forms of Child Care
There are lots of types of child care available near myself, including daycare facilities, home-based care, and preschool programs. Daycare facilities are generally large services that can accommodate numerous children, while home-based attention providers work from their very own homes. Preschool programs are designed to prepare young ones for preschool and past, with a focus on very early training and socialization.
Each type of child care features its own advantages and disadvantages. Daycare centers provide a structured environment with qualified staff and academic activities, however they may be expensive and may have long waiting lists. Home-based treatment providers offer an even more personalized and versatile strategy, but may not have the exact same level of supervision as daycare centers. Preschool programs supply a very good academic basis for children, but is almost certainly not suited to all households as a result of cost or area.
Advantages of Childcare
Child care offers many benefits for kids and families. Studies have shown that children who attend high-quality childcare programs will be successful academically and socially later on in life. Childcare in addition provides moms and dads with peace of mind, understanding that their children are in a secure and nurturing environment while they are at work.
Furthermore, childcare can help kids develop essential social and emotional abilities, such as for instance empathy, collaboration, and conflict quality. Kids who attend childcare programs also provide the chance to connect to colleagues from diverse backgrounds, helping them develop a sense of tolerance and acceptance.
Challenges of Child Care
Despite its many benefits, child care in addition presents challenges for households. One of the biggest difficulties is the cost of childcare, that can easily be prohibitively high priced for several families. Furthermore, finding top-quality childcare near myself is difficult, particularly in areas with minimal choices.
Another challenge may be the possibility return among childcare providers, which can interrupt the stability and continuity of maintain children. Also, some families could have concerns concerning the quality of treatment supplied in some childcare configurations, resulting in anxiety and doubt about their child's well-being.
